| Abstract | This paper presents an experimental study to investigate the effects of ground granulated blast furnace slag (GGBFS) fineness, cement type and curing age on the drying shrinkage and microstructure of GGBFS blended cement mortar. The test results revealed that the drying shrinkage evolution can be significantly affected by GGBFS powder fineness, cement type, specific surface area and 6~30nm porosity, but curing age. As a result of this study, the prediction equation of drying shrinkage is proposed based on ESW specific surface area, the volume of 6~30nm diameter pore and mass loss. |
